SMU Graduate Tuition and Fees

Part-time graduates at SMU paid an average of $1,704 per credit hour in 2019-2020. This tuition was the same for both in-state and out-of-state students. Information about average full-time graduate student t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$40,896$40,896
Fees$6,582$6,582

Does SMU Offer an Online Master’s in Education Admin?

SMU does not offer an online option for its education admin master’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the SMU Online Learning page.

During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 63 master’s degrees in education admin hand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their master’s degree in education admin in 2019-2020, 76.2% of them were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 69.6%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 69.8% of education admin master’s degree recipients at SMU in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 31%.
